THE HOUSE: An Italianate Victorian home of gracious design with plentiful natural light. It's prominent in the Mystic Historic District and sited in a garden of specimen trees & shrubs creating all season interest. Restored by Owners, both Architects, the tall ceilings, gracious rooms, large windows, striking detail, hand-planed panel doors, and plank floors evoke a prosperous period in Mystic's Seafaring Heritage. Captain Wheeler sailed ships to China. The original design of his substantial home has been preserved, incorporating new systems and modern conveniences.
